![]() ![]() Mean and average voltages - Oscilloscopes can calculate the average or mean of your signal, and it can also tell you the average of your signal's minimum and maximum voltage.Maximum and minimum voltages - The scope can tell you exactly how high and low the voltage of your signal gets.Peak amplitude, on the other hand, only measures how high or low a signal is past 0V. There are a variety of amplitude measurements including peak-to-peak amplitude, which measures the absolute difference between a high and low voltage point of a signal. Amplitude - Amplitude is a measure of the magnitude of a signal. ![]() These characteristics are important when considering how fast a circuit can respond to signals. The duration of a wave going from a low point to a high point is called the rise time, and fall time measures the opposite.
